Americans Exposed to Hantavirus on Cruise Ship Under Quarantine or Returning to U.S.
Eighteen American passengers exposed to hantavirus aboard the MV Hondius cruise ship are under quarantine at a hospital in Omaha, according to DailySabah. Another source, Bluesky, reported that two Americans being monitored for hantavirus are flying back to New York.
